Question
solve the equation.
log₇(x + 2) - log₇x = 2
select the correct choice below and fill in any answer boxes present in your choice.
a. x =
(simplify your answer, including any radicals. use integers or fractions for any numbers in the expression.
b. there is no solution.
Step1: Apply log - subtraction rule
Using the rule $\log_aM-\log_aN = \log_a\frac{M}{N}$, we rewrite the left - hand side of the equation: $\log_7\frac{x + 2}{x}=2$.
Step2: Convert to exponential form
By the definition of logarithms, if $\log_ab=c$, then $b=a^c$. So, $\frac{x + 2}{x}=7^2=49$.
Step3: Solve for x
Multiply both sides by $x$: $x + 2=49x$. Then subtract $x$ from both sides: $2=49x−x = 48x$. Divide both sides by 48: $x=\frac{2}{48}=\frac{1}{24}$.
